Thomas [Re-Titled by Moderator]. More Less. We designed BigBlueButton to be a highly collaborative system. If we wanted to handle hundreds of simultaneous users, we would have restricted the sharing of webcams and audio channels. There is no such restriction in BigBlueButton. Like many open source projects, at the core of the project are a team of developers that have responsibility for core development and overall quality of the project. The current committers are as follows:.
The committers have earned this responsibility through years of contribution to BigBlueButton and to related open source projects i. As the Lead Architect for our project, he has the final say. The committers are very active in the support and mentoring of other developers in the bigbluebutton-dev mailing list. The committers group is not closed. Any developer that wishes to become a committer can achieve it through participation.
The decision of expanding the committers group rests with the committers. During the planning process, the committers decide on the main features for a release by reviewing the BigBlueButton Road Map along with all starred issues and, in particular, issues marked with tags stability and usability. We review the features according to the development priorities for our target market see When will feature X be implemented?
After the planning phase, each feature for the release is assigned an issue in the BigBlueButton Issue Tracker if it does not already have one. This allows the community to track the progress of each release. For small features, especially bug fixes, the associate issue provides a sufficient record for coordinating and tracking the development effort. For more complex features, such as record and playback, API changes, or creation of an HTML5 client, the lead developer for the feature would post specifications to BigBlueButton-dev for review and comment.
During the development phase, the committers hold bi-weekly and sometimes weekly calls as development proceeds towards beta. Each committer works on a fork of the BigBlueButton Master. When a feature is ready for commit, the committer sends a pull request to merge the work into the Master branch. Since the core group is still small and the committers are communicating during development, Richard and others know when any major pull requests are coming.
The submitter of the pull request is responsible for ensuring the feature works correctly against Master. For pull requests that make major changes, the submitter must provide with the pull request additional documentation to make it easy for others to review:. Each commit is reviewed by another committer who is familiar as well with the area of the product. If the reviewer of the update believes it will negatively affect stability or usability, the request will be rejected and the developer will need to rework the request based on feedback by the reviewer.
Once an update has been committed, it is tested by other developers in the latest build. In that way a build will iterate through development towards beta.
The release stays in development until all core development is finished and all obvious bugs have been fixed. Before the beta release, the documentation for installation, setting up of the development environment, and overview of new features are all updated for the release. Once a release is moved to beta, the public Ubuntu packages are updated so others in the BigBlueButton community can begin installing and using the build. The product will go through one or more betas until the community reports no more major bugs.
Additional work that occurs during this phase includes:. We strive to have very stable beta releases. As the release moves through iterations in beta, members of the community will start to run BigBlueButton on production servers. Yes, some run it for months on production. When all the bugs are fixed and issues are closed, the product moves to Release Candidate. For us the release candidate is done — which means issue a release is changing only the label of the build. We tend to wait for at least two weeks of community use before we change the label to release.
Again, stability is paramount for reaching a release candidate build. During the stage at release candidate the core committers monitor the mailing lists, twitter, and feedback from members to look for any bugs or issues that would impact the delivery of general release. After a roughly two week period in which no one has reported any issues for a release candidate, the committers change the label such as 0. BigBlueButton exists because many developers have contributed their time and expertise to its development.
The BigBlueButton client is written in Javascript. Like other open source projects, a good place to start is to try fixing an open issue. You can also browse the bugs by labels: Stability - Usability - Performance - Localization - Research. You could also try tackling one of the enhancements to BigBlueButton.
Some bugs are more important than others. Stability and usability issues are very important to the BigBlueButton community. You can become proficient in the installation and configuration of a BigBlueButton server. Each month, there are many new users in bigbluebutton-setup that need help with setup of BigBlueButton, especially setup behind a firewall.
You can contribute a language file. You could point out any errors to this documentation. Such assistance reduces the support load on us and gives us more time to work on improving BigBlueButton. Any contribution by external members for inclusion into BigBlueButton will be reviewed by one or more of the committers.
The process for submission and review depends on the complexity of the contribution and requires that you have signed a Contributor License Agreement. Therefore, everyone wishing to send us a pull request for review must have a signed Contributor License Agreement in place.
To obtain a committer agreement, download BigBlueButton Inc. Contributor Agreement. Except as set out in the agreement, you and your employer if you have an intellectual property agreement in place keep all right, title, and interest in your contribution. If you and your employer are in agreement with its terms be sure to use a physical mailing address for the address section to make it legal , then sign, scan, and e-mail a copy back to Fred Dixon ffdixon at bigbluebutton dot org.
Once we receive the signed Contributor Agreement, we can review your submission for inclusion in BigBlueButton. Android provides nothing similar. Outlook like other mobile clients does not download attachments automatically. This behavior is by design, in order to conserve device space. Attachments are only downloaded at the request of the user.
Outlook for iOS stores attachments in our own database. As a result, every attachment we download to the client takes up a considerable amount of space in our database.
To ensure the client is able to provide fast performance and take a small amount of space, we purge data rather aggressively based on usage attachments will be cached up to seven days. Unlike iOS, Android uses an accessible file system, so when Outlook for Android downloads an attachment, it doesn't go into the database, rather it is stored as a temporary file.
Whenever those options are changed, Outlook for iOS performs a soft reset. This operation wipes the existing data that has been downloaded to the app and requires a resynchronization. Outlook for iOS provides your company's organization information as part of a person's contact card details.
Your company's reporting structure and a list of colleagues is also provided, to help employees connect with the people and teams they need to work with.
The list of people displayed as part of the Other Colleagues list under Show Organization is based on common email distribution lists, group memberships, and degrees of separation in the Organization structure defined in Azure Active Directory. For initial folder synchronization, Outlook for iOS and Android synchronizes items per folder, with up to items per folder if the user taps Load more conversations. The app periodically trims the items per folder down to the default number, in order to ensure optimal app performance. Microsoft's strategic direction for task management and note taking on mobile devices is the To-Do and OneNote apps, respectively.
To-Do provides integration with the tasks stored in Exchange Online mailboxes; however, Outlook for iOS and Android provides users the ability to create tasks from messages and exposes top tasks in the Zero Query search pane. No, Outlook for iOS and Android does not support moderated message requests for approving or rejecting email.
